Introducción. Tema 10a. Introducción. Memoria RAM. Memoria RAM HDD

Documentos relacionados
Tema 0. Introducción a los computadores

MEMORIAS. Arquitectura de Computadoras. (Conceptos Introductorios) M. C. Felipe Santiago Espinosa

1. Partes del ordenador. Nuevas Tecnologías y Sociedad de la Información

INFORMATICA I EJERCICIOS PROPUESTOS Buscar en el diccionario Qué es INFORMÁTICA?, Qué es

Área Académica: Informática. Tema: Informática I. Profesor(a): Ing. Miriam Cerón Brito. Periodo: Julio Diciembre 2017

Partes de una computadora. Conceptos Generales. Elementos de Computación (CU) Computación (TIG) El Hardware de una computadora

SOFTWARE DE APLICACIÓN. CINDEA Sesión 02

HARDWARE INFORMÁTICO. Las computadoras son componentes de Entrada, Proceso, Salida, Almacenamiento y Control

Conceptos básicos y manual de procedimientos para Windows e Internet

Docente: Sandra Romero Otálora SISTEMA DE COMPUTO INTRODUCCIÓN A LOS COMPUTADORES CONCEPTOS BÁSICOS

El Computador y sus Partes INTRODUCCIÓN A LAS TECNOLOGÍAS INFORMÁTICAS

Unidad V: Sistemas de archivos 5.1 Concepto

Introducción a los Ordenadores. Dept. Ciencias de la Computación e I.A. Universidad de Granada

Dep. Tecnología / MJGM NOCIONES BÁSICAS INFORMATICA 4º ESO. Nociones básicas 1

Fundamentos de las TIC

Ing. Rojas Córsico, Ivana

INFORMÁTICA HARDWARE Y SOFTWARE

Tema 2.3. Hardware. Unidades de Almacenamiento

Arquitectura de un sistema microinformático

Subsistemas de memoria. Departamento de Arquitectura de Computadores

Tema 5: Memorias. Espacio reservado para notas del alumno

Unidad 3: Gestión de Archivos

Sistemas Operativos. Curso 2016 Sistema de Archivos

REQUISITOS Cuaderno 50 hojas cuadros. CD/DV/Memory Carpeta

Administración de la producción. Sesión 1: Conceptos básicos de la computadora

Periféricos. A través de los periféricos se comunica el procesador que en definitiva es el que procesa la información de los usuarios en el computador

Las unidades de almacenamiento. El disco duro. Imprimir. Imagen:

Organización del Sistema de Memoria. 1. Tipos de memoria 2. Jerarquía de memoria 3. El principio de localidad 4. Organización de la memoria

ARQUITECTURA DE ORDENADORES. Colegio Compañía de María Departamento de Tecnología Autor: Gerardo Parra Gil

Organización del Computador I. Introducción e Historia

Es todo lo tangible, material, o físico que se puede tocar del equipo de computo, por ejemplo: monitor, ratón, teclado, bocinas, gabinete.

Informática Básica. 2º Diplomatura en Ciencias Empresariales Universidad Pública de Navarra. Informática Básica, DCE-UPNA 1

Componentes de los Ordenadores

Arquitectura de un sistema de cómputo

INFORME MEMORIA CACHE Y MEMORIA VIRTUAL.

Dispositivos de almacenamien to secundario. Almacenamiento de datos

GESTION DE ENTRADA Y SALIDA

Computadoras en la Oficina. Profa. María L. Moctezuma Dewey University 29/07/2014

Sistemas de memoria. Estructura de computadores 2

Estructura del Computador

Sistemas Informáticos

Los sistemas de información contienen información acerca de personas, lugares y cosas importantes dentro de la organización o en su entorno.

Partes de la Computadora: Equipo central. Partes de la Computadora: Equipo periférico

Página 1 de 12 CONCEPTOS INFORMÁTICOS BÁSICOS

EL ORDENADOR HARDWARE SOFTWARE

T2.- Unidades funcionales de un ordenador. TEMA 2 UNIDADES FUNCIONALES DE UN ORDENADOR. T2.- Unidades funcionales de un ordenador.

Versión: 01. Fecha: 26 /01 /2016. Código: F004-P006-GFPI GUÍA TALLER DE APRENDIZAJE N.1: EL COMPUTADOR 1. IDENTIFICACIÓN DE LA GUIA DE APRENDIZAJE

Se define como base de un sistema de numeración, el número de dígitos distintos que utiliza. Así, en el sistema decimal la base es 10.

Comandos para manipulación de archivos y directorios Parte II

Tema 4. Estructura de un ordenador elemental

Sesión No. 1. Contextualización INFORMÁTICA 1. Nombre: Conceptos básicos de la computadora

COMPONENTES BÁSICOS DE UNA TARJETA MADRE

Tabla de interrupciones

SISTEMAS OPERATIVOS Arquitectura de computadores

La memoria del ordenador

TEMA 1: Concepto de ordenador

Bibliografía básica de referencia: Fundamentos de Informática para Ingeniería Industrial, Fernando Díaz del Río et al.

1. Un procedimiento de respaldo debe comenzar con un respaldo completo. 2. A los discos flexibles (floppies) se les llama con frecuencia floppets.

Dispositivos temporales. Características

HISTORIA. Winchester 3030 empezó a utilizar la actual tecnología de cabezas flotantes. Podía almacenar 30 Mb

TEMA 2: Organización de computadores

4. Escribe con palabras lo que significan las siguientes letras y di cuántos bytes hay aproximadamente: a) 1 Gb? b) 1 Mb? C) 1 Kb?

Computación Conociendo la herramienta de cálculo

Noticia: Información almacenada hasta la Luna.

Informática Tema: H a r d w a r e

Estructura básica de un ordenador

Sistemas Electrónicos Industriales II EC2112

El ordenador y equipamiento informático

Introducción a las Computadoras

DISPOSITIVOS DE ALMACENAMIENTO

Institución Educativa Distrital Madre Laura Tecnología e Inform ática GRADO 7

Un sistema informático es encargado de recoger y procesar los datos y de transmitir la información.

El espectro de almacenamiento (Jerarquías de Memorias)

Apuntes Informática 4º ESO Tema 1: Sistemas Informáticos. Sistemas Operativos (Parte 1)

Proceso de información en la computadora

INFORMÁTICA PARA

COLEGIO ALFONSO LÓPEZ MICHELSEN ÁREA DE TECNOLOGÍA E INFORMÁTICA GRADO SÉPTIMO ACTIVIDAD 3 SISTEMAS OPERATIVOS PARA CPU Y CELULARES

MANTENIMIENTO DE EQUIPO DE CÓMPUTO. CINDEA Sesión 08

Organización de Computadoras. Turno Recursantes Clase 8

Breve 1 y 2 Introducción. Arquitectura básica y Sistemas Operativos. Programación. Fundamentos de Informática

INTRODUCCIÓN 1. ORDENADOR E INFORMÁTICA

NAUTILUS. El navegador de archivos Nautilus. nombre.extensión

Ficheros Contenido del Tema

Organización de la información en disco: archivos y carpetas

Esta unidad describe cómo se almacena la información en los dispositivos magnéticos.

Tema 1: Arquitectura de ordenadores, hardware y software

Introducción a la Informática

Fundamentos de Programación. Archivos (Ficheros)

TEMA 7: Ficheros. TEMA 7: Ficheros Concepto de fichero

Iniciación a la informática

TEMA 1. IMPLANTACIÓN DE SISTEMAS OPERATIVOS MODO ESCRITORIO. 2 FPB INFORMÁTICA DE OFICINA IES NUM. 3 LA VILA JOIOSA

Archivos. Teoría de Sistemas Operativos. Archivos. Archivos. Archivos. Archivos. Administración de Archivos

Instituto Universitario Politécnico. Santiago Mariño. Unidad Nº I: Nociones generales de la. computación. Elaborado por: Ing. Víctor Valencia.

VOCABULARIO DEL HARDWARE. Docente Yeni Ávila

Herramientas Informáticas I Software: Sistemas Operativos

Introducción a los Sistemas Informáticos

Arquitectura del Computador. Programación 1 er semestre 2013

UNIDAD CENTRAL DE PROCESO.


Algunos de los componentes que se encuentran dentro del gabinete o carcaza de la computadora.

Transcripción:

Introducción Tema 10a Manejo de archivos Un computador puede almacenar grandes cantidades de información. Puede acceder a ella de manera muy rápida. Para hacer cualquier cosa es necesario tener MEMORIA disponible, para almacenar variables, recordar valores, etc. Esta memoria puede ser volátil o persistente. Introducción Memoria RAM CPU A+B=C Memoria primaria (volátil) A B C Memoria secundaria (persistente) Datos.txt RAM: RandomAccess Memory. Acceso aleatorio. Volátil, por tanto insegura. Capacidades de cientos de MB. Velocidad de acceso: Del orden de los nanosegundos (10-9 seg.) 133 MHz 8 ns Implica que puede transmitir mas de 1 GB/seg. Memoria RAM Es necesario Evitar la volatilidad de la memoria RAM. Aumentar su capacidad a costos razonables. Realizar respaldos de información. HDD HDD: Hard Drive Disk Acceso aleatorio. Persistente y confiable. Capacidades de decenas de GB. Velocidad de acceso Del orden de los milisegundos (10-3 seg) 5 10 ms Transmiten en tasas de decenas de MB/seg. 1

Cintas magnéticas Acceso secuencial. Cada cinta almacena cientos de GB. Persistente y muy confiable. Se crean bibliotecas de cintas, que alcanzan las decenas o cientos de TB. Velocidad de acceso Del orden de los milisegundos. Transmiten en tasas de decenas de MB/seg. (menos que un HDD y considerando acceso secuencial). Otros Otros discos magnéticos Discos de 3.5 y 5.25 Discos Zip SuperDisk Discos ópticos CD DVD Memoria ROM La memoria secundaria puede almacenar cantidades inmensas de información. Para organizar los datos en ella, se crean los conceptos de archivos. Además, se crea el concepto de directorio. Unidad de disco Directorios Los archivos son entidades que define el sistema operativo para identificar un conjunto de datos Un archivo tiene un conjunto de atributos Nombre y extensión. Ubicación (muchas veces es solo parte del nombre). Tamaño. Tipo. Permisos: Lectura, escritura y ejecución (puede estar especificado por usuarios y grupos) Fecha de creación y modificación. Etc... Debido a su facilidad de uso y compresión, muchos sistemas utilizan archivos especiales para manejar dispositivos Teclado Entrada secuencial Pantalla Salida secuencial Impresora Salida secuencial Red, Serial, paralela E/S secuencial Etc... Todo se resume a saber manejar archivos Si manejan archivos, manejarán al mundo. 2

Se pueden realizar un conjunto de operaciones a través del sistema operativo con los archivos: Abrir Cerrar Leer Escribir Mover a una posición (solo acceso aleatorio) Para abstraer la interacción entre los archivos y los programas que realicen operaciones sobre ellos, se define el concepto de flujo. Un flujo es como una manguera por donde fluyen datos en uno o ambos sentidos. chao 1 chao Abrir un flujo VAR Antes de poder utilizar un flujo, debemos abrirlo. Al momento de abrirlo se especifica el modo Abrir Leer Solo lectura (r) Solo escritura (w) Lectura/escritura (rw) Al abrir: Escribir Cerrar Se asigna un descriptor del archivo a nuestro programa Se modifica el estado del archivo 3

Abrir un flujo Estado de un archivo Si esta abierto para lectura, otros programas pueden también abrirlo para lectura, pero no para escritura. Si está abierto para escritura, nadie más puede abrirlo. Cerrar un flujo Al terminar de usarlos, los flujos deben ser cerrados. Al cerrar los flujos, nuevamente se modifica el estado del archivo (para que otros puedan abrirlo). Al salir del programa de manera normal, los flujos se cierran en forma automática. Si el programa termina de manera anormal, los flujos pueden quedar abiertos. Leer desde un flujo Los archivos contienen información binaria. Esta información puede representar cualquier cosa. Los archivos se separan en dos grandes grupos de texto binarios Al momento de leer, hay que tener claro el tipo de archivo desde el cual se desea leer información. Leer desde un flujo de texto Se pueden leer letras, palabras o frases completas. Por lo general se leen de manera secuencial, desde la primera letra hasta el fin de archivo. Leer desde un flujo binario Pueden contener cualquier cosa. Por lo general se leen de manera aleatoria. Pueden contener estructuras de datos. Escribir en un flujo También depende del tipo de archivo. Por lo general, el escribir en un flujo no significa que la información se guarde de manera inmediata en el archivo. La operación de escritura en memoria secundaria es muy costosa. Para mejorar el rendimiento se utiliza un buffer. 4

2 datos [Llenando buffer] 5 datos [Llenando buffer] 1 datos [buffer lleno] Escribir en un flujo Mover a una posición Acción permitida solo para archivos de acceso directo. Al abrir un archivo, se define una posición al comienzo de este. Al leer o escribir de manera secuencial, esta posición se actualiza automáticamente al la posición siguiente. Se puede modificar de manera manual esta posición para leer o modificar un datos especifico o en un orden distinto al secuencial. [Vaciando buffer] Fin tema 10a Manejo de archivos 5